    New Trail is a solid spot located in an industrial area of Williamsport, PA. This place is all…read moreabout the beer, with a factory vibe in the tasting area adjacent to the brewery. There's a full selection of New Trail's offerings on tap. They don't offer flights per se, but you can order 4-ounce pours. Food is limited to food trucks on site. The beer is excellent and fresh since you are enjoying it right at the source. New Trail ships around the region and beyond and has grown into a reasonably good sized business. As such, the overall tasting room experience feels a little...corporate...with plenty of merch on offer in addition to the beer. As others have noted, the exterior spaces are functional but basically tables in a gravel area off a parking lot. I get it--there's not much you can do with that location. However, if beer is your priority then the rest is secondary. Definitely recommend.

    Rock Bottom is a seriously local, family owned establishment outside Lock Haven, PA. This charming…read morelocal pub has nice views of the West Branch of the Susquehanna River and exceedingly friendly staff. I first visited Rock Bottom with friends several years ago--shortly after it changed ownership. It was a pleasant stop, but things have continued to improve. The owner has improved the river view by carefully tending a riverfront lot across the street and keeping large windows. There's also a side deck with river views. Thus family-owned establishment has great service and a friendly clientele who are welcoming to all. The tap system is currently offline but Rock Bottom has a nice selection of domestic bottled beers. Four stars only because we didn't have a chance to try the food; bar service was great If you're in the Lock Haven area definitely check out this local jewel. You'll have a good time and probably make some new friends.
